Position Summary:
The Wave Operations Coordinator utilizes the Fulfillment Center (FC) Warehouse Management System (WMS) to allocate tasks among the available workforce in the Fulfillment Center (FFC) in the most effective way possible. The incoming client orders and the release of 'picks' are strategically distributed throughout the physical FFC and along the process path (single, multi, ship alone) through the use of software, mathematical analysis, and ongoing communication in a fast-paced environment.
